Kyndryl
DevelopmentEngineer-Java/SpringBoot/Microservices
Neural analysis suggests this role is
optimal for Senior candidates.
“Development Engineer - Java / Spring Boot / Microservices at Kyndryl. Skills: Java, Spring Boot, Microservices, REST APIs. Design backend services using Java. Develop backend services using Spring Boot”
What You'll Achieve.
See immediate value of work; Deliver value to customers faster; Ensure success of products; Ensure components ready for integration; Significant impact on products' success; Contribute to culture of empathy; Contribute to shared success; Make a difference in cloud-based managed services; Shape what's next
Industry & Context.
Solving complex problems; Problem-solving; Debugging skills; Troubleshoot; Debug; Resolve production issues
What They're Looking For.
Must Have
6+ years of experience in Java development (8 or above), Hands-on experience with Spring Boot, Spring MVC, Spring Data JPA, Experience in microservices architecture and REST API development, Knowledge of databases (Oracle, MySQL, PostgreSQL), Familiarity with version control systems (Gitlab), Experience with build tools (Maven / Gradle), Understanding of SDLC and Agile methodologies, problem-solving and debugging skills, Knowledge of containerization (Docker) and orchestration (Kubernetes), Experience with CI/CD tools (Jenkins, GitLab CI, Azure DevOps), Exposure to messaging systems (Kafka, RabbitMQ), Knowledge of API security (OAuth2, JWT)
Nice to Have
Experience with cloud platforms (Azure), Experience with Observability and Monitoring (Prometheus, Dynatrace, ELK), Prior experience in Banking / BFSI domain, Hands-on experience with Kubernetes for container orchestration, Experience working in highly scalable and distributed systems
What You'll Do.
Design backend services using Java
Develop backend services using Spring Boot
Build microservices architecture
Maintain microservices architecture
Integrate with internal/external systems
Follow best practices
Perform integration testing
Troubleshoot production issues
Debug production issues
Resolve production issues
Participate in Agile ceremonies
Optimize application performance
Ensure high availability
Support deployment activities
Support release activities
Implement identified components
Document implemented components
Unit-test implemented components
Provide work estimates
Guide features being built
Guide functional objectives being built
Guide technologies being built
How You'll Work.
Team & Collaboration
Collaborate with business analysts; Collaborate with QA teams; Collaborate with architects; Work closely with product; Work with interested parties; Inclusive work with others
Process & Methodology
Sprint planning, Provide work estimates
Full Job Description
**Who We Are** At Kyndryl, we run and reimagine the mission-critical technology systems that drive advantage for the world’s leading businesses. We are at the heart of progress; with proven expertise and a continuous flow of AI-powered insight, enabling smarter decisions, faster innovation, and a lasting competitive edge. For our people—Kyndryls—that means doing purposeful work that powers human progress. Join us and experience a flexible, supportive environment where your well-being is prioritized and your potential can thrive. **The Role** Are you passionate about solving complex problems? Do you thrive in a fast-paced environment? Then there’s a good chance you will love being a part of our Software Engineering – Development team at Kyndryl, where you will be able to see the immediate value of your work. As a Development Engineer - Java / Spring Boot / Microservices at Kyndryl, you will be at the forefront of designing, developing, and implementing cutting-edge software solutions. Your work will play a critical role in our business offering, your code will deliver value to our customers faster than ever before, and your attention to detail and commitment to quality will be critical in ensuring the success of our products. * Design and develop backend services using Java and Spring Boot * Build and maintain microservices architecture for scalable applications * Develop RESTful APIs and integrate with internal/external systems * Collaborate with business analysts, QA teams, and architects * Write clean, maintainable, and efficient code following best practices * Perform unit testing, integration testing, and code reviews * Troubleshoot, debug, and resolve production issues * Participate in Agile ceremonies (sprint planning, stand-ups, retrospectives) * Optimize application performance and ensure high availability * Support deployment and release activities Using design documentation and functional programming specifications, you will be responsible for implementing
Applying for this Development Engineer - Java / Spring Boot / Microservices role?
Most applicants get filtered before a human reads their resume. See if yours makes the cut.
How to Apply on Workday
- Workday has a multi-step form — save your progress after every section.
- "Apply With LinkedIn" can fail or lose data; manual entry is more reliable.
- Watch for the "Submit for Review" final step — hitting "Save" alone does not submit.
- Job requisition numbers are useful when following up with HR by email.
ANONYMOUS · UNFILTERED
What do employees actually say about Kyndryl?
Real rants from real employees. Read before you apply.